Can a C1 driver's license be upgraded to an A2?

1 Answers
LaNaomi
07/29/25 1:43pm
A C1 license cannot be directly upgraded to an A2. With a C1 driver's license already in hand, the fastest way to obtain an A2 license is to upgrade to a B1 or B2 license after holding the C1 license for one year. After obtaining the B1 or B2 license, you must have three years of professional driving experience before you can apply for the A2 license. Therefore, upgrading from a C1 to an A2 license takes at least four years. Alternatively, you can take a second approach by directly obtaining a B2 license. With three years of driving experience after obtaining the B2 license, you can then upgrade to an A2 license. This method is faster, though it does not involve upgrading directly from a C1 license. According to the "Regulations on the Application and Use of Motor Vehicle Driver's Licenses" (Ministry of Public Security Order No. 123) of the People's Republic of China, the following conditions must be met for upgrading a driver's license: Article 14: Holders of a motor vehicle driver's license applying to add permitted vehicle types must not have accumulated 12 penalty points in the current scoring cycle or the most recent scoring cycle before application. Applicants seeking to add medium-sized buses, tractor-trailers, or large buses as permitted vehicle types must also meet the following requirements: Applicants seeking to add medium-sized buses must have held a license for city buses, large trucks, small cars, small automatic transmission cars, low-speed trucks, or three-wheeled vehicles for at least three years and must not have accumulated 12 penalty points in the three most recent consecutive scoring cycles before application. Applicants seeking to add tractor-trailers must have held a license for medium-sized buses or large trucks for at least three years, or have held a license for large buses for at least one year, and must not have accumulated 12 penalty points in the three most recent consecutive scoring cycles before application. Applicants seeking to add large buses must have held a license for medium-sized buses, city buses, or large trucks for at least five years, or have held a license for tractor-trailers for at least two years, and must not have accumulated 12 penalty points in the five most recent consecutive scoring cycles before application. In temporary residence areas, permitted vehicle types that can be added include small cars, small automatic transmission cars, low-speed trucks, three-wheeled vehicles, ordinary three-wheeled motorcycles, ordinary two-wheeled motorcycles, and light motorcycles. Article 15: The following circumstances disqualify applicants from applying for large buses, tractor-trailers, medium-sized buses, or large trucks: Being responsible for a fatal traffic accident with equal or greater liability; Driving under the influence of alcohol; Having a driver's license revoked or rescinded within the past ten years. According to the "Permitted Vehicle Types and Codes" (Ministry of Public Security Order No. 139) of the People's Republic of China: The A1 license permits driving large buses, specifically large passenger vehicles, and also allows driving vehicles under A3, B1, B2, C1, C2, C3, C4, and M. According to the "Permitted Vehicle Types and Codes" (Ministry of Public Security Order No. 139) of the People's Republic of China: The A2 license permits driving tractor-trailers, specifically heavy and medium-sized full trailers or semi-trailer combinations, and also allows driving vehicles under B1, B2, C1, C2, C3, C4, and M.

Should the Car's Center Console Be Dismantled for Rattling Noises?

It is not necessary to dismantle the car's center console for rattling noises. The areas under the center console that might produce noise are only the steering column and the brake and clutch pedals below. The car's center console is the area that controls comfort and entertainment devices such as the air conditioning and audio system. It includes the central door lock system, allowing the driver to control the opening and closing of all doors and the window lift system. The central door lock system primarily has three functions: central control, speed control, and individual control. The driver can operate all door locks, and when the vehicle reaches a certain speed, the doors automatically lock. Other doors have independent switches, allowing individual control. The car's center console also includes the central control panel, which houses various vehicle controllers such as the audio control panel.

What are the hidden features of the Haval H6 Platinum Champion Edition?

Haval H6 Platinum Champion Edition hidden features include: 1. Auto re-lock function: When the vehicle is in a locked state, after unlocking the doors, if no door or trunk is opened within 30 seconds, the vehicle will automatically lock again; 2. Failed lock reminder: When the engine is off with ignition switch in LOCK position, the doors cannot be properly locked if any door remains unclosed; 3. Emergency door locking. Taking the 2020 Haval H6 1.5GDIT Automatic Platinum Champion Edition as an example: It is a compact 5-door 5-seat SUV under Great Wall Motors, measuring 4600mm in length, 1860mm in width, and 1720mm in height with a 2680mm wheelbase, equipped with a 7-speed dual-clutch transmission.

How to Set Up the Hidden Feature of Horn Sound When Locking the Tiguan L?

The hidden feature of horn sound when locking the Tiguan L cannot be set up by yourself. It requires visiting a 4S store to reprogram the ECU. The horn sound function when locking the car is set to silent by default in the factory settings of the Volkswagen Tiguan models. Here are some details about the Tiguan L: 1. Body Dimensions: The vehicle's body dimensions are 4712 mm in length, 1839 mm in width, and 1673 m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2791 mm. 2. Other Details: The vehicle is a five-door, five-seat or seven-seat SUV with a fuel tank capacity of 60 liters and a luggage compartment volume ranging from 495 liters to 1780 liters. The model is positioned as a mid-size SUV.

What does active grille shutter mean?

Active grille shutter refers to an air intake grille that can automatically adjust its opening degree. Here are some additional details: 1. After starting the vehicle, the active grille shutter automatically adjusts its opening based on the engine temperature, achieving rapid warm-up effects. This allows the engine to reach its optimal operating state in the shortest time possible, especially during cold winters. Faster warm-up also means passengers can enjoy warm air sooner. Temperature significantly impacts engine performance, and the engine operates most fuel-efficiently at its optimal working temperature. Therefore, accelerating the engine's transition to its ideal operating temperature in cold conditions indirectly improves fuel economy. 2. When driving at high speeds, excessively open windows increase wind resistance, burdening the vehicle. As the car's 'front gate,' if the air intake grille remains wide open, it will inevitably increase wind resistance and fuel consumption. Timely closure of the grille results in a lower drag coefficient, enhancing both vehicle stability and fuel efficiency.

What are the contents of the manual transmission test in Subject 2?

Subject 2, also known as the small road test, is part of the motor vehicle driver's license assessment and is the abbreviation for the field driving skills test subject. The C1 test items include five mandatory tests: reversing into the garage, parallel parking, stopping and starting on a slope, making a right-angle turn, and driving through curves (commonly known as S-turns). Some areas also include a sixth item: high-speed toll card collection. The points deduction for Subject 2 is as follows: 1. Not wearing a seatbelt: deduct 100 points. 2. Starting the engine with the gear not in neutral: deduct 100 points. 3. Stalling once: deduct 10 points. 4. Wheels pressing against the edge line: deduct 100 points. 5. Stopping for more than 2 seconds during the test: deduct 5 points. 6. Not following the prescribed route or sequence: deduct 100 points.

What is Fuel Injection Timing?

Fuel injection timing refers to the correct fuel supply time of the injection pump, generally expressed by the fuel injection advance angle. The fuel injection advance angle is the crankshaft rotation angle from when the No.1 cylinder plunger of the injection pump begins supplying fuel until the piston of that cylinder reaches top dead center. Below is the relevant introduction: The fuel injection advance angle is the crankshaft rotation angle from when the No.1 cylinder plunger of the injection pump begins supplying fuel until the piston of that cylinder reaches top dead center. Generally, the fuel injection advance angle for diesel engines is 15-25°. If the fuel injection advance angle is too large or too small, it will affect the engine's working performance. When a vehicle has traveled a certain mileage or after the injection pump has been overhauled and reinstalled during maintenance, the fuel injection timing must be checked and adjusted to ensure the diesel engine operates under the optimal or near-optimal fuel injection advance angle.
